**Ticket: Config drift on BounceSift processor**

The email bounce processor in the Larkfield environment has drifted from the values committed in the release branch. Retry windows and suppression thresholds no longer match, which likely explains the duplicate suppression entries reported Tuesday. Please reconcile before the Thursday cut. For reference, the currently deployed configuration on the live node reads as follows.

config for yajep-yahof:
[briax]
port = 9200
region = outer-2
host = briax.nelvrocorp.test
team = raleth
timeout_ms = 1500
retries = 1

Fan-out backpressure for the Quillet notifier: when the queue depth crosses the soft limit, the dispatcher sheds low-priority pushes and batches the rest at 500ms intervals. Reviewer should confirm the shed counter is exported and that retries respect the jitter window. Once merged, the release artifact gets re-signed by the pipeline, which expects the deploy key shown below.

deploy key for bawep-yawif: bky6_GQhaSt

## Sensor drift: what to do at 3am

If the GrowLoop controller starts reporting humidity swings that don't match the backup probes in the Fernwick greenhouse, it's almost always sensor drift, not an actual climate event. Don't panic and don't touch the vents manually. First, restart the calibration daemon and give it ten minutes to re-baseline. If readings still disagree by more than 5%, flip the controller into safe mode. The safe-mode thresholds it will use are these.

config for yahap-bajof:
[istix]
host = istix.qorvelsys.internal
user = istix_svc
database = istix_prod